Transaction 2596538c865468b18c97a33f1c3ad08432d1ed012827fdcd0f536abb312ce939
1 Input
1 Output
-
2596538c865468b18c97a33f1c3ad08432d1ed012827fdcd0f536abb312ce939:0
- value
- 109590
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 45ab65d1b71bee0360a8edeb164b734efa731ce2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17MNxAFNPHkJJHYUso8tgoXoseWZQ4n5Jm